How much do plating j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 13, 2026, the average hourly pay for plating in Indiana is $22.42,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$16.92 and $23.32 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the typical daily responsibilities of someone working in plating?

As a Plating professional, your daily tasks usually include preparing metal parts for plating, operating and monitoring plating tanks, maintaining proper chemical concentrations, and inspecting finished products for quality. You may also be responsible for cleaning and maintaining equipment, recording process data, and adhering to strict safety protocols. Collaboration with quality control teams and production supervisors is common to ensure that final products meet industry standards. This role often requires standing for extended periods and wearing appropriate protective gear, making attention to safety and consistency essential parts of your daily routine.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in plating, and why are they important?

To thrive in a Plating role, you need strong attention to detail, manual dexterity, and a basic understanding of chemistry or metalworking, typically supported by a high school diploma or technical training. Familiarity with plating equipment, safety protocols, and quality inspection tools such as micrometers or thickness gauges is often required. Reliability, problem-solving skills, and the ability to follow precise instructions help individuals excel in this position. These skills are critical to maintaining high-quality production standards and ensuring a safe, efficient work environment.

What is plating?

A Plating job involves applying a thin layer of metal onto a surface to enhance durability, conductivity, or appearance. Workers in this role operate plating equipment, prepare materials, and ensure proper coating thickness. They follow safety guidelines and quality standards to achieve the desired finish. Plating is commonly used in industries such as manufacturing, aerospace, and electronics.

What does a plating technician do?

A plating technician applies metal coatings to objects through electroplating or other methods to improve appearance, corrosion resistance, or durability. They prepare surfaces, operate plating equipment, and ensure quality standards are met, often working in a manufacturing or industrial environment. Knowledge of safety procedures and technical skills are essential for this role.

Summary/Objective:    The Plating Process Engineer is responsible for continuous improvement of the plating process on quality, on time delivery and cost. The Plating Process Engineer is part of the Plating Team for the development, testing and implementation of new materials and technology. The Plating Process Engineer is responsible for test plan development, administration of process recipes, industrial engineering functions, and project management.
Essential Functions/ Responsibilities: 
  • Support global Plating Operations with a high level of integrity with the evaluation, development and implementation of new processes, materials and technologies.  These continuous improvement efforts will be directed towards safety, quality, service, and cost.
  • Lead cross-functional teams for process control and improvement projects, supported by the use of Six Sigma Tools as DOE, hypothesis testing, SPC, etc.
  • Keep process documentation updated and meeting all requirements for manufacturing, safety and environmental standards.
  • Work with the Quality and Operations groups for continuous quality improvement and scrap reduction projects. Lead quality improvement projects to identify and eliminate recurring quality problems.
  • Work with the Plating Laboratory Supervisor to lead and support projects for chemical process control and improvement, including SPC on key chemical process variables.
  • Work with Lead R&D Chemist to implement and troubleshoot new plating chemistry innovations.
  • Work with New Ventures Engineering to implement new processes and technologies.
  • Provide technical support on precious metal usage and reduction projects to meet the company goals.
  • Provide guidance to New Product Engineering for plating capabilities and implement Win/Win solutions to problems in product development.
  • Manage recipes for new product setup and existing product optimization.
  • The responsibilities as defined are intended to serve as a general guideline for this position. Associates may be asked to perform additional tasks depending on strengths and capabilities.
  • Additional requirements for this position may be needed based on the facility in which this is located. 
Required Education/Experience: 
 
  • Bachelor of Science Degree in Engineering or a Technical or Science degree or minimum 2 Years' Experience in Process, Chemical, Manufacturing or an equivalent engineering position.
  • Essential functions of the job include the ability to stand, lift, and walk on a continual basis.
  • Must be willing to work in a chemical environment.
  • Must be a self-starter with strong teamwork skills.
  • Must be able to work independently and learn quickly.
  • Good communication skills both written and verbal.
 
Preferred Education/Experience: 
  • Experience in an electroplating environment.
  • Training in Lean manufacturing, Continuous Improvement, Statistical Process Control, and Six Sigma.
